| 5 Listings Available | N/A Listings Sold in 2021 | $131 Median Price/Per SqFt | $349,900 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$64,350 Median List Price | View Listings |
| 380 Listings Available | N/A Listings Sold in 2021 | $142 Median Price/Per SqFt | $252,502 Median List Price | View Listings |
| 24 Listings Available | N/A Listings Sold in 2021 | $138 Median Price/Per SqFt | $195,975 Median List Price | View Listings |
| 8 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$194,473 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$349,900 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$42 Median Price/Per SqFt | $316,888 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| $250 Median Price/Per SqFt | $3,500,000 Median List Price | View Listings |
| 59 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$199,900 Median List Price | View Listings |
| 33 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$37,000 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| $67 Median Price/Per SqFt | $242,500 Median List Price | View Listings |
| 281 Listings Available | N/A Listings Sold in 2021 | $157 Median Price/Per SqFt | $313,498 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$87 Median Price/Per SqFt | $372,000 Median List Price | View Listings |
| 186 Listings Available | N/A Listings Sold in 2021 | $75 Median Price/Per SqFt | $125,000 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$160,000 Median List Price | View Listings |
| 80 Listings Available | N/A Listings Sold in 2021 | $37 Median Price/Per SqFt | $64,860 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$55,000 Median List Price | View Listings |
| 416 Listings Available | N/A Listings Sold in 2021 | $51 Median Price/Per SqFt | $229,900 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$199,900 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| $37 Median Price/Per SqFt | $55,400 Median List Price | View Listings |
| 69 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$40,000 Median List Price | View Listings |
| 4,860 Listings Available | N/A Listings Sold in 2021 | $175 Median Price/Per SqFt | $353,358 Median List Price | View Listings |
| 13 Listings Available | N/A Listings Sold in 2021 | $147 Median Price/Per SqFt | $309,990 Median List Price | View Listings |
| 61 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$75,000 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$54,580 Median List Price | View Listings |
| 384 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$79,950 Median List Price | View Listings |
| 376 Listings Available | N/A Listings Sold in 2021 | $94 Median Price/Per SqFt | $249,950 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$91 Median Price/Per SqFt | $132,450 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$75,000 Median List Price | View Listings |
| 23 Listings Available | N/A Listings Sold in 2021 | $130 Median Price/Per SqFt | $135,000 Median List Price | View Listings |
| 370 Listings Available | N/A Listings Sold in 2021 | $148 Median Price/Per SqFt | $206,950 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| $63 Median Price/Per SqFt | $125,000 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$72 Median Price/Per SqFt | $107,350 Median List Price | View Listings |
| 200 Listings Available | N/A Listings Sold in 2021 | $62 Median Price/Per SqFt | $185,400 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| $91 Median Price/Per SqFt | $611,450 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$17,700 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$200,000 Median List Price | View Listings |
| 182 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$85,950 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$535,500 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$1,999,000 Median List Price | View Listings |
| 22 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$132,000 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$47,600 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$40,000 Median List Price | View Listings |
| 5 Listings Available | N/A Listings Sold in 2021 | $107 Median Price/Per SqFt | $250,000 Median List Price | View Listings |
| 25 Listings Available | N/A Listings Sold in 2021 | $117 Median Price/Per SqFt | $115,000 Median List Price | View Listings |
| 170 Listings Available | N/A Listings Sold in 2021 | $62 Median Price/Per SqFt | $145,000 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$229,000 Median List Price | View Listings |
| 53 Listings Available | N/A Listings Sold in 2021 | $78 Median Price/Per SqFt | $124,900 Median List Price | View Listings |
| 227 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$79,900 Median List Price | View Listings |
| 52 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$105,900 Median List Price | View Listings |
| 24 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$139,900 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$73,500 Median List Price | View Listings |
| 5 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$250,000 Median List Price | View Listings |
| 11 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$15,900 Median List Price | View Listings |
| 281 Listings Available | N/A Listings Sold in 2021 | $111 Median Price/Per SqFt | $205,000 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$134,500 Median List Price | View Listings |
| 123 Listings Available | N/A Listings Sold in 2021 | $130 Median Price/Per SqFt | $189,000 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$237,450 Median List Price | View Listings |
| 13 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$129,900 Median List Price | View Listings |
| 188 Listings Available | N/A Listings Sold in 2021 | $60 Median Price/Per SqFt | $184,450 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| $93 Median Price/Per SqFt | $274,950 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| $185 Median Price/Per SqFt | $499,900 Median List Price | View Listings |
| 149 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$199,900 Median List Price | View Listings |
| 7 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$525,000 Median List Price | View Listings |
| 63 Listings Available | N/A Listings Sold in 2021 | $122 Median Price/Per SqFt | $130,000 Median List Price | View Listings |
| 246 Listings Available | N/A Listings Sold in 2021 | $85 Median Price/Per SqFt | $278,900 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$73 Median Price/Per SqFt | $365,992 Median List Price | View Listings |
| 957 Listings Available | N/A Listings Sold in 2021 | $163 Median Price/Per SqFt | $291,900 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$73 Median Price/Per SqFt | $199,900 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$199,000 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| $376 Median Price/Per SqFt | $649,000 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$156 Median Price/Per SqFt | $288,450 Median List Price | View Listings |
| 2,373 Listings Available | N/A Listings Sold in 2021 | $148 Median Price/Per SqFt | $265,900 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| $129 Median Price/Per SqFt | $239,900 Median List Price | View Listings |
| 46 Listings Available | N/A Listings Sold in 2021 | $72 Median Price/Per SqFt | $177,500 Median List Price | View Listings |
| 7 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$414,988 Median List Price | View Listings |
| 40 Listings Available | N/A Listings Sold in 2021 | $55 Median Price/Per SqFt | $158,138 Median List Price | View Listings |
| 64 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$143,850 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$699,000 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| $83 Median Price/Per SqFt | $457,450 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$47 Median Price/Per SqFt | $337,500 Median List Price | View Listings |
| 122 Listings Available | N/A Listings Sold in 2021 | $127 Median Price/Per SqFt | $274,900 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$305,350 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| N/A Median List Price | View Listings |
| 505 Listings Available | N/A Listings Sold in 2021 | $147 Median Price/Per SqFt | $325,000 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| $176 Median Price/Per SqFt | $292,250 Median List Price | View Listings |
| 2,300 Listings Available | N/A Listings Sold in 2021 | $140 Median Price/Per SqFt | $350,378 Median List Price | View Listings |
| 11 Listings Available | N/A Listings Sold in 2021 | $144 Median Price/Per SqFt | $240,000 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| $83 Median Price/Per SqFt | $199,000 Median List Price | View Listings |
| 11 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$99,900 Median List Price | View Listings |
| 11 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$110,000 Median List Price | View Listings |
| 2 Listings Available | N/A Listings Sold in 2021 | $67 Median Price/Per SqFt | $342,000 Median List Price | View Listings |
| 14 Listings Available | N/A Listings Sold in 2021 | $144 Median Price/Per SqFt | $197,400 Median List Price | View Listings |
| 134 Listings Available | N/A Listings Sold in 2021 | $164 Median Price/Per SqFt | $209,900 Median List Price | View Listings |
| 140 Listings Available | N/A Listings Sold in 2021 | $48 Median Price/Per SqFt | $105,550 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$554,000 Median List Price | View Listings |
| 1,355 Listings Available | N/A Listings Sold in 2021 | $222 Median Price/Per SqFt | $339,990 Median List Price | View Listings |
| 4 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$150,000 Median List Price | View Listings |
| 9 Listings Available | N/A Listings Sold in 2021 | $87 Median Price/Per SqFt | $185,000 Median List Price | View Listings |
| 11 Listings Available | N/A Listings Sold in 2021 | $66 Median Price/Per SqFt | $84,900 Median List Price | View Listings |
| 62 Listings Available | N/A Listings Sold in 2021 | $99 Median Price/Per SqFt | $134,900 Median List Price | View Listings |
| 93 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$36,000 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$749,950 Median List Price | View Listings |
| 218 Listings Available | N/A Listings Sold in 2021 | $105 Median Price/Per SqFt | $189,900 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$100,000 Median List Price | View Listings |
| 1 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$100,000 Median List Price | View Listings |
| 53 Listings Available | N/A Listings Sold in 2021 | $93 Median Price/Per SqFt | $165,000 Median List Price | View Listings |
| 63 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$150,000 Median List Price | View Listings |
| 2,125 Listings Available | N/A Listings Sold in 2021 | $180 Median Price/Per SqFt | $659,900 Median List Price | View Listings |
| 12 Listings Available | N/A Listings Sold in 2021 | $175 Median Price/Per SqFt | $437,400 Median List Price | View Listings |
| 1,428 Listings Available | N/A Listings Sold in 2021 | $183 Median Price/Per SqFt | $406,238 Median List Price | View Listings |
| 3 Listings Available | N/A Listings Sold in 2021 | N/A Median Price/Per SqFt | $350,000 Median List Price | View Listings |